In Silver this year, I'm pretty sure Melaka had the "-ol" to start the season, but then it dropped. Perhaps, going forward, we should adopt some standardization as part of the Our League structure. Here's what I propose: All teams should add either of the common identifiers to the end of names, that is "-ol" or (ol). All teams should add + to their abbreviation. I would also strongly suggest that we adopt the abbreviation standard we used in ESSOM, the Strat play by mail league I played in. Last time I checked, the league had run for 35 years, and might still be going. The abbreviation standard is: Two word team names: Redmond Birds becomes REB + Two word cities, one word nickname: Green Lake Cowboys becomes GLC + One word city, two word nicknames: Shasta Black Bears becomes SBB + Two word cities, two word nicknames: Ewa Beach Fighting Chickens becomes EFC + Idiosyncratic spellings: CliffMarkle Roadrunners becomes CMR + In the rare cases that this system duplicates abbreviations, simply move on to the letter to the right to differentiate them: Harland Clifts, Hattiesburg Cornhuskers both yield HAC. Harland becomes HRC ot Hattieburg becomes HTC. Santa Ana Killers, Sanibel Knights both yield SAK. Santa Ana keeps the SAK, and Sanibel becomes SNK. This need only apply in levels where teams are together. There are nearly 70 teams in Our League.
